At present, the most common misunderstanding among the public is that the organization that undertakes prosthetic assembly by default is equivalent to the prosthetic manufacturer. This is not the case in the actual industry. Most prosthetic limb assembly companies on the market do not have product production qualifications and processing capabilities. The prosthetic limb parts circulating on the market are produced by professional manufacturers. The assembly company purchases corresponding parts according to customer needs and completes assembly and debugging.
Excluding the purchased standardized accessories, the entire set of prostheses only has a socket that fits the residual limb and bears the force, which is independently processed and manufactured by the assembly mechanism. This also means that when choosing a prosthetic limb assembly mechanism, there is no need to worry too much about brands and accessory channels. The core evaluation criterion is the institution’s professional and technical ability to process and produce sockets.
The fitting effect of the socket depends entirely on the professional level and craftsmanship of the practical technician, which directly determines the wearing comfort and walking stability of the prosthetic limb. Regardless of the brand and performance of outsourced prosthetic accessories, once the socket is made with insufficient precision and poor fit, the final wearing experience will be greatly compromised.
Another industry status quo is popularized: all compliant prosthetic limb accessories on the market can be purchased by most assembly institutions in the industry, and there is no exclusive source of supply. At the same time, disorderly low-price competition is common in the prosthetic industry, and there is a huge gap between the quotations of similar products.
Under the premise of market-oriented operation, the assembly organization needs to cover the costs of consumables, space, labor, and after-sales. There is no long-term loss in accepting orders. Abnormally low-price quotations will mostly reduce process, consumables, and after-sales costs, and subsequent problems such as adaptation failures and wearing injuries are prone to occur.
Taken together, the core variable of prosthetic wearing effect is never the accessory brand, but the production and fitting technology of the practical technician. Experienced technicians can combine the shape of each person's residual limbs, stress conditions, and skin conditions to customize a socket that meets the standard of fit to ensure a basic wearing experience. When selecting a prosthetic service agency, the safest choice is to give priority to verifying technician qualifications, practical cases, and socket manufacturing processes.
